HEALTH ADVICE FOR TRAVELLERS TO
TROPICAL COUNTRIES
Be well prepared so you can enjoy your stay
You can get information about the
country visiting from your travel agent or each country’s
Embassy. If you think you will need special medical advice then
you should see your doctor at least two months before your
departure.

If you want to take any medicine
abroad with you, then find out from your local chemist if you
are allowed to take into the country you are visiting.
